Summary:The invention relates to a saponin derivative based on a saponin comprising a triterpene aglycone and at least one of a first saccharide chain and a second saccharide chain linked to the aglycone core structure, wherein the saponin derivative comprises an aglycone core structure comprising an aldehyde functional group which has been transformed to a semicarbazone functional group. The invention also relates to a first pharmaceutical composition comprising the saponin derivative of the invention. In addition, the invention relates to a pharmaceutical combination comprising the first pharmaceutical composition of the invention and a second pharmaceutical composition comprising for example an ADC or a GalNAc-oligonucleotide conjugate. The invention also relates to the first pharmaceutical composition or the pharmaceutical combination of the invention, for use as a medicament, or use in the treatment or prophylaxis of a cancer or an auto-immune disease, a cardiovascular disease or hypercholesterolemia, or in a method for lowering LDL-cholesterol in the circulation of a subject. The invention also relates to a saponin conjugate comprising a proteinaceous molecule, capable of binding to a cell, and optionally comprising an effector moiety such as an oligonucleotide. The invention also relates to a saponin conjugate comprising GalNAc and an oligonucleotide.
